Discussion of the name

Mainard is a Continental Germanic masculine name comprising the elements magan ‘strength, power’ and hart ‘hard’ (Forssner 1916: 181).

The only entries in the PASE corpus are for Maginhard 1-2, an early tenth-century moneyer active at an unspecified mint, and Mainard 1, a catch-all category for occurrences of this name in DB.

Forms of the name

Spellings in Domesday Book: Mainard(us)

Forms in modern scholarship:

  von Feilitzen head forms: Mainard

  Phillimore edition: Maynard (and Mainard in Index)

  Alecto edition: Mainard, Maynard
